This cutting-edge project is to design a Smart Electrical Panel that seamlessly integrates advanced control boards, including RUTX11, Intel NUC, a smart touchscreen panel, and robust features for home automation and energy efficiency. Leveraging SolidWorks, this project aims to create an intelligently designed electrical panel that not only ensures efficient energy management but also provides a user-friendly interface for home automation.
Utilizing a din rail configuration, this panel incorporates circuit breakers, power terminals, and ground terminals, providing a secure and organized setup. The upper DIN rails house the RUTX11 shielded by a sturdy sheet metal design mount, ensuring protection from external elements. Additionally, the Intel NUQ is strategically positioned with its own sheet metal mount, safeguarding it from potential harm.

As the lead designer, I was tasked with creating an enclosure that not only accommodated the control PCBs and a light switch but also met stringent manufacturing standards, including tolerance analysis, flow simulation, and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T). The design process involved a detailed analysis of an existing model, noting every dimension to recreate and optimize the design. This required extensive CAD work and flow simulations for thermal management, in collaboration with the manufacturing team, to ensure the enclosure was both functional and manufacturable.
